Re: any 2 tone paint jobs on 67/68 sheetmetal
I find it interesting that some of the white roof trucks have the front pillars painted white also and others just the roofs are white. I'm assuming all white (including front pillars) is factory, right?

Re: any 2 tone paint jobs on 67/68 sheetmetal
Thee A pillars were body color on 67's only. In 68 the whole top was white.
